Idle control malfuction DTC is a result of the ECU not being able to maintain closed loop control of idle speed. There are a ton of possible causes for that. If you search idle surge and other common idle problems you can uncover a ton of info. www.crebotech.com and www.vfaq.com are good resources for this. One of the problems I really try not to troubleshoot over the internet is idle control. It really is a complicated system.
